Abstract
A first reproduction circuit reproduces a digital stereo audio signal from a signal which is read by means of a pickup from a disc loaded at a playback position, and a second reproduction circuit reproduces an analog audio signal from the signal read by the pickup. When the disc loaded at the playback position is identified as being a Laser vision Disc with Digital sound (LDD) disc, the stereo audio signal outputted from the first reproduction circuit is mixed with the analog audio signal outputted from the second reproduction circuit, such that a vocal portion of a reproduction can be reproduced together with an accompaniment portion of the reproduction, in a stereo mode.
